(1) organize your stuff.
there's a great book about this you can get from the library - called "it's all too much."
or, you can simply look at each item and ask yourself "is this beautiful, useful or does it make me money?" if the answer is "no," give it away or pitch it. http://www.clothingdonations.org/service.htm for free home item pickup by the vietnam vets' assn.
(2) keep a monthly calendar - one which you can carry with you. my favorite is $10 from target.
(3) put all received bills in one box with your checkbook, envelopes and stamps.
(4) on one of the Tools Days - Day 20something? there is an explanation of maintaining a "to do list." very helpful!
